The volume of passenger and freight transport on a given railway line depends on many socio-economic factors. Therefore, before starting an investment on a railway line, various analyses are carried out regarding the choice of the line and the scope of works. This article presents the calculation of weights determining the impact of specific socio-economic factors on the volume of rail passenger and freight transport using the Analytical Hierarchy Process (AHP) method. Thereafter, a comparison was made of 12 railway lines located in various regions of Poland in terms of their use in both passenger and freight transport. Half of the analysed railway lines are main lines, while the other part are local lines. The comparison made it possible to arrange the selected lines regardless of their category.
